.category-controls-sticky-detector{height:1px}.category-controls{background:#fff!important;padding:15px 0;position:sticky;z-index:1039}.category-title{font-family:var(--heading-font);font-size:16px;font-weight:700}.filter-link{display:inline-block;padding:10px 0;width:100%}.product-table{gap:.5rem}.product-table .item-product{margin:0}.product-table .item-product.col-1{flex-basis:calc(8.33333%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-1{flex-basis:calc(8.33333% - 0.5rem)!important}}.product-table .item-product.col-2{flex-basis:calc(16.66667%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-2{flex-basis:calc(16.66667% - 0.5rem)!important}}.product-table .item-product.col-3{flex-basis:calc(25%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-3{flex-basis:calc(25% - 0.5rem)!important}}.product-table .item-product.col-4{flex-basis:calc(33.33333%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-4{flex-basis:calc(33.33333% - 0.5rem)!important}}.product-table .item-product.col-5{flex-basis:calc(41.66667%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-5{flex-basis:calc(41.66667% - 0.5rem)!important}}.product-table .item-product.col-6{flex-basis:calc(50%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-6{flex-basis:calc(50% - 0.5rem)!important}}.product-table .item-product.col-7{flex-basis:calc(58.33333%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-7{flex-basis:calc(58.33333% - 0.5rem)!important}}.product-table .item-product.col-8{flex-basis:calc(66.66667%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-8{flex-basis:calc(66.66667% - 0.5rem)!important}}.product-table .item-product.col-9{flex-basis:calc(75%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-9{flex-basis:calc(75% - 0.5rem)!important}}.product-table .item-product.col-10{flex-basis:calc(83.33333%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-10{flex-basis:calc(83.33333% - 0.5rem)!important}}.product-table .item-product.col-11{flex-basis:calc(91.66667%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-11{flex-basis:calc(91.66667% - 0.5rem)!important}}.product-table .item-product.col-12{flex-basis:calc(100% - 0.5rem)}@media (min-width:768px){.product-table .item-product.col-md-12{flex-basis:calc(100% - 0.5rem)!important}}.category-banner img{aspect-ratio:10/1;-o-object-fit:cover;object-fit:cover}.subcategory-banner img{height:100%;-o-object-fit:cover;object-fit:cover}@media (min-width:768px){.category-controls{padding:0;position:relative}.category-title{font-family:var(--heading-font);font-size:36px;font-weight:700}.product-table{gap:.5rem;margin-bottom:1.5rem;row-gap:1rem}.category-banner img{aspect-ratio:15/1;-o-object-fit:cover;object-fit:cover}.subcategory-banner img{height:100%;-o-object-fit:cover;object-fit:cover}}.cambio-vistas{align-items:center;background-color:#ff7f7f;border-radius:15px;display:flex;height:-moz-fit-content;height:fit-content;margin-bottom:auto;margin-right:.9375rem;margin-top:auto;position:relative;width:-moz-fit-content;width:fit-content;z-index:999}.cambio-vistas .btn-vistas{align-items:center;background:none;border:none;cursor:pointer;display:flex;padding:9px 15px;z-index:2}.cambio-vistas .desktop-views,.cambio-vistas .mobile-views{display:none}.cambio-vistas .btn-vistas svg{fill:#000;height:.875rem;width:auto}.cambio-vistas .btn-vistas.selected{background-color:var(--accent-color);border-radius:20px}.cambio-vistas .btn-vistas.selected svg{fill:#000}.cambio-vistas .titulo-pre{display:flex;justify-content:space-between}@media (max-width:767px){.cambio-vistas .mobile-views{display:flex}}@media (min-width:768px){.cambio-vistas .desktop-views{display:flex}}.js-fullscreen-modal{height:100%}.custom-filters-button{font-size:14px;font-weight:700}.btn-agregar-filtro{background:#000;border-radius:50px;color:#fff;font-weight:700;margin-top:10px;padding:10px 20px;width:-moz-fit-content;width:fit-content}.accordion-button{align-items:center;background:none;border:none;cursor:pointer;display:flex;justify-content:space-between;padding:1.25rem 0;text-align:left;width:100%}.filter-name,.js-fullscreen-modal-close .title-filters-apply{font-size:16px;font-weight:600}.filters-to-apply{display:flex;flex-wrap:wrap;gap:8px}.btn-agregar-filtro:hover{color:#fff}@media (max-width:768px){.form-min-max{border:1px solid #ccc;border-radius:6px;font-size:14px;outline:none;padding:8px 12px;width:100%}.form-min-max:focus{border-color:#000}.price-filter{display:flex;flex-direction:column;gap:8px}.checkbox-item,.order-by-option{font-size:13px}}@media (max-width:1000px){.filters-views{display:none}}.grid-mode-toggle{gap:8px}.grid-mode-btn{cursor:pointer;opacity:.4;transition:opacity .2s}.grid-mode-btn.--active{color:#111;opacity:1}.grid-mode-btn:hover{color:#fff;opacity:.7}@media screen and (min-width:1024px){.js-product-table.--editorial{align-items:start;display:grid!important;gap:10px;grid-auto-rows:auto;grid-template-columns:repeat(4,minmax(0,1fr))}.js-product-table.--editorial .js-item-product{flex:none!important;margin:0!important;max-width:100%!important;padding:0!important;width:100%!important}.js-product-table.--editorial .js-item-product .p-relative{height:382px!important;overflow:hidden!important;padding-bottom:0!important;position:relative!important}.js-product-table.--editorial .js-item-product .js-item-image{display:block!important;height:100%!important;left:0!important;-o-object-fit:cover!important;object-fit:cover!important;-o-object-position:center top;object-position:center top;position:absolute!important;top:0!important;width:100%!important}.js-product-table.--editorial .js-item-product:nth-child(2){grid-column:1;grid-row:1}.js-product-table.--editorial .js-item-product:nth-child(3){grid-column:2;grid-row:1}.js-product-table.--editorial .js-item-product:nth-child(4){grid-column:1;grid-row:2}.js-product-table.--editorial .js-item-product:nth-child(5){grid-column:2;grid-row:2}.js-editorial-banner{display:flex;flex-direction:column;height:100%}.js-editorial-banner-01{grid-column:3/span 2;grid-row:1/span 2}.js-editorial-banner-02{grid-column:1/span 2;grid-row:4/span 2}.js-editorial-banner-03{grid-column:3/span 2;grid-row:7/span 2}.js-editorial-banner .editorial-banner-img{display:block;flex:1;min-height:0;-o-object-fit:cover;object-fit:cover;width:100%}.js-editorial-banner .editorial-banner-name:after{background-color:var(--accent-color);content:"";display:block;height:2.5px;margin-top:4px;width:50px}.js-editorial-banner .editorial-banner-info{padding:8px 4px}.js-editorial-banner .editorial-banner-brand{color:#666;font-size:1.1rem;margin-bottom:2px}.js-editorial-banner .editorial-banner-name{font-size:16px;font-weight:500;margin-bottom:4px}.js-editorial-banner .editorial-banner-dec{font-size:14px;margin-bottom:6px;margin-top:6px}.js-editorial-banner .editorial-banner-prices{align-items:center;display:flex;flex-wrap:wrap;gap:8px}.js-editorial-banner .editorial-banner-price-compare{color:#999;font-size:16px;text-decoration:line-through}.js-editorial-banner .editorial-banner-price{font-size:16px;font-weight:600}.js-editorial-banner .editorial-banner-discount{color:#e00;font-size:1.1rem;font-weight:500}}@media (min-width:1501px){.js-product-table.--editorial .js-item-product .p-relative{height:580px!important}.js-product-table.--editorial .js-item-product .js-item-image{height:100%!important}}@media screen and (max-width:1023px){.js-product-table.--editorial{display:flex!important;flex-wrap:wrap}.js-product-table.--editorial .js-item-product{flex:0 0 50%!important;max-width:50%!important;width:50%!important}.js-editorial-banner{display:none!important}}
/*# sourceMappingURL=grid_critical.min.8360e7c2.css.map */